How to Get to Arapiles

Flying to:

  • Adolfo Suarez Madrid-Barajas Airport (MAD), 7.7 mi (12.4 km) from Arapiles

Getting to Arapiles on Metro

Stations in the neighborhood include:

  • Quevedo Station
  • Canal Station
  • San Bernardo Station

When Is the Best Time to Visit Madrid?

  • Hottest months: July, August, June, September (average 77°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, March (average 45°F)
  • Rainiest months: October, November, April, March (average 2 inches of rainfall)
